> +/*
> + * Temp stub: generates address adjustment for PointerMasking
> + */
> +static void gen_pm_adjust_address(DisasContext *s,
> + TCGv *dst,
> + TCGv src)
> +{
> + tcg_gen_mov_tl(*dst, src);
> +}
I mentioned before that you would not be able to do this.
You are writing to the live cpu register, even if in this case it's a nop.
You could, for example, make the stub be
*dst = src;
but that begs the question of why not use the return value, and have the stub be
return src;
